Brevo vs Loops

Loops scores higher on the AgentReady, 66/100 against 33/100. They differ on 16 of the 41 signals. Which ones decides whether an agent can adopt them without a person watching.

What each one is

Brevo. One AI-powered customer platform for all your marketing and sales needs.

Loops. Loops is an email platform for building and managing lifecycle email with AI agents.

Where Brevo is ahead

Brevo passes agent-compatible signup flow, and Loops does not. That is adopt, whether an agent can get a key and make its first successful call without a human in the loop.

Where Loops is ahead

Loops passes clear canonical domain, clear product positioning, public docs discoverable, llms.txt published, llms-full.txt / full agent docs, mcp discoverable and machine-readable metadata, and Brevo does not. That is discover, whether an agent can find the product at all without being told it exists.

It also holds understand: authentication documented and limits / constraints documented. Brevo misses those.

And on adopt, fast time to first request, copyable quickstart, official python sdk, cli available and mcp integration available. Brevo misses those.

Finally, on operate, agent compatibility verified. Brevo misses it.

What neither does

Both fail structured api reference, openapi / spec quality, request examples provided, response examples provided, errors and status codes documented, no mandatory sales call, programmatic credential creation, structured, predictable output, machine-readable errors, retry behavior documented, idempotency support, rate-limit behavior predictable. If your agent needs any of those, you will be building it yourself either way.

Score, pillar by pillar

The AgentReady splits into four pillars, scored separately, because a product can be easy to find and still impossible to adopt.

Discover is whether an agent can find the product at all without being told it exists. Loops leads 100 to 33. Brevo misses clear canonical domain, clear product positioning, public docs discoverable, llms.txt published, llms-full.txt / full agent docs, mcp discoverable, machine-readable metadata; Loops misses nothing.

Understand. Loops leads 38 to 23. Brevo misses structured api reference, openapi / spec quality, authentication documented, request examples provided, response examples provided, errors and status codes documented, limits / constraints documented; Loops misses structured api reference, openapi / spec quality, request examples provided, response examples provided, errors and status codes documented.

Adopt. Loops leads 71 to 40. Brevo misses no mandatory sales call, programmatic credential creation, fast time to first request, copyable quickstart, official python sdk, cli available, mcp integration available; Loops misses no mandatory sales call, agent-compatible signup flow, programmatic credential creation.

Operate. Loops leads 53 to 35. Brevo misses structured, predictable output, machine-readable errors, retry behavior documented, idempotency support, rate-limit behavior predictable, agent compatibility verified; Loops misses structured, predictable output, machine-readable errors, retry behavior documented, idempotency support, rate-limit behavior predictable.

Pricing

Brevo starts at $8/mo and has a free tier. Loops does not publish one and has a free tier.
